Output 0ddd59d62149da9f2836daf428d4b3ac5340c119a7a41f4acbb8a08a84c60e53:5

value
506798593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d31dff2e0d4da696f4cbe8afec66e53e9682c9 OP_EQUAL
address
3LukjWLX8yqqocRs9FVqdttKtbQTkzMPzo
transaction
0ddd59d62149da9f2836daf428d4b3ac5340c119a7a41f4acbb8a08a84c60e53
spent
true